The Mechanics of 5 Steps To Bury Dead Apps On Your Pc Forever

So, how can you effectively bury dead apps on your PC forever? The process is simpler than you think and can be broken down into five manageable steps.

Step 1: Identify and Categorize Your Apps

The first step in burying dead apps is to identify and categorize the ones you no longer need or use. Start by opening the ‘Control Panel’ on your Windows PC or ‘About This Mac’ on your Mac. From there, navigate to the ‘Programs and Features’ or ‘Applications’ section, respectively. This will give you a list of all installed apps on your computer. Next, categorize the apps into three groups: frequently used, occasionally used, and never used.

Step 2: Uninstall Unused Apps

Once you’ve identified the apps you no longer need, it’s time to uninstall them. To do this, simply right-click on each app and select ‘Uninstall.’ Be sure to also remove any associated files or folders to prevent clutter from building up again.

Step 3: Remove Leftover Files and Folders

After uninstalling unused apps, you’ll likely be left with leftover files and folders. Use the ‘Disk Cleanup’ tool on Windows or ‘About This Mac’ on your Mac to remove any unnecessary files and free up storage space.

Step 4: Update and Reinstall Essential Apps

Now that you’ve decluttered your computer, it’s essential to update and reinstall any essential apps. This will ensure you have the latest features and security patches.

Step 5: Schedule Regular Maintenance

Finally, schedule regular maintenance to prevent digital clutter from building up again. Set reminders to update your apps, clean up your computer, and check for malware.

Myths and Misconceptions Surrounding Digital Decluttering

Myth 1: Digital Decluttering is Time-Consuming

This couldn’t be further from the truth. Decluttering your computer can be a straightforward process that’s completed in a few hours.

Myth 2: You Need Specialized Software

While there are many excellent tools available to aid in digital decluttering, they’re not necessary. Most computers come equipped with built-in tools that can help you clean up your digital space.

Myth 3: Digital Decluttering is a One-Time Event

A common misconception is that digital decluttering is a one-time event. However, digital clutter can accumulate quickly, making regular maintenance essential to maintain a clutter-free computer.
